OpenClaw(龙虾)在macOS Sequoia怎么设置代理完整流程
2026-03-19 1
详情
报告
跨境服务
文章
引言
OpenClaw(龙虾)是一款面向开发者与技术型跨境运营人员的开源网络调试工具,常用于模拟不同地区IP访问、测试广告投放落地页、抓取竞品数据等场景。其核心能力是提供本地HTTP/SOCKS代理服务,支持规则路由、TLS解密与流量重放。‘代理’指将本机网络请求经由指定服务器中转,以改变出口IP或绕过地域限制。

要点速读(TL;DR)
- OpenClaw非商业软件,无官方Mac App Store版本,需终端命令行安装与配置;
- macOS Sequoia(15.x)系统默认启用SIP和Privacy Protection,需手动授权网络监控权限;
- 设置代理需三步:安装OpenClaw → 启动服务 → 在系统网络设置中配置HTTP/HTTPS/SOCKS代理地址(localhost:8080等);
- 不兼容System Settings中‘自动代理配置(PAC)’方式,必须使用手动代理;
- 部分杀毒软件(如CrowdStrike、Microsoft Defender for Mac)会拦截OpenClaw进程,需添加例外。
它能解决哪些问题
- 广告投放预审卡顿:跨境卖家测试Facebook/Google/TikTok广告落地页在目标国家加载效果时,需真实IP环境验证,OpenClaw可配合海外代理IP实现本地化调试;
- 多账号风控隔离:运营多店铺(如Amazon美国站+欧洲站)时,通过不同端口绑定独立代理链路,避免浏览器指纹与IP交叉污染;
- API接口调试受限:对接Shopify、WooCommerce或ERP系统时,部分API强制校验Referer或User-Agent,OpenClaw支持自定义请求头重写,满足合规调用条件。
怎么用/怎么开通/怎么选择
OpenClaw无注册、无账号、无订阅制,属本地运行工具。以下为macOS Sequoia下完整实操流程(基于v0.13.0+版本):
- 确认系统环境:macOS Sequoia 15.0+,已安装Homebrew(若未装,执行
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"); - 安装OpenClaw:终端执行
brew install openclaw(官方源:https://github.com/openclaw/openclaw); - 启动服务:运行
openclaw --http-port 8080 --https-port 8443 --socks-port 1080(端口可自定义,建议避开已占用端口); - 授予全盘访问权限:前往【系统设置】→【隐私与安全性】→【完全磁盘访问】→ 点击“+”添加终端.app(或iTerm2等实际运行终端);
- 配置系统代理:进入【系统设置】→【网络】→【当前连接】→【详情】→【代理】→ 勾选【网页代理(HTTP)】和【安全网页代理(HTTPS)】,地址填
127.0.0.1,端口填对应值(如8080);SOCKS代理同理; - 验证代理生效:打开终端执行
curl -x http://127.0.0.1:8080 https://httpbin.org/ip,返回结果应为上游代理IP(非本机IP),即成功。
费用/成本通常受哪些因素影响
- OpenClaw本身免费开源,无许可费、无订阅费、无并发数限制;
- 实际成本取决于所对接的上游代理服务提供商(如Bright Data、Smartproxy、Oxylabs等)的计费模式(按流量/带宽/会话/静态IP数量);
- macOS Sequoia下若启用TLS解密功能(--mitm),需手动导入OpenClaw根证书至钥匙串并设为“始终信任”,该步骤不影响费用但影响HTTPS流量捕获成功率;
- 企业级使用中,若需日志审计、多用户权限管理或集群部署,则需自行搭建管理前端或集成Prometheus/Grafana,产生额外开发与运维成本。
常见坑与避坑清单
- Sequoia系统代理设置失效:新版系统设置中代理开关位于【网络】→【详情】→【代理】,而非旧版“高级”标签页,路径易错;
- HTTPS流量无法捕获:未执行
openclaw --mitm启动,或未将~/.openclaw/cert.pem导入钥匙串并设为“始终信任”; - Chrome/Safari不走代理:macOS系统代理仅对遵循系统配置的应用生效;Chrome需关闭“使用系统代理设置”(chrome://settings/system),Safari默认跟随系统;Electron类应用(如Slack、Figma)需单独配置;
- 防火墙拦截监听端口:检查“系统设置→隐私与安全性→防火墙→防火墙选项”是否阻止了终端或OpenClaw进程通信。
FAQ
OpenClaw(龙虾)在macOS Sequoia怎么设置代理完整流程靠谱吗/正规吗/是否合规?
OpenClaw是MIT协议开源项目,代码公开可审计(GitHub仓库stars超2.1k,commit活跃),不收集用户数据。其代理行为本身符合《计算机信息网络国际联网管理暂行规定》,但上游代理IP来源及用途需卖家自行确保合规(如不得用于爬取受Robots.txt禁止的站点、不得伪造身份进行平台批量注册)。
OpenClaw(龙虾)在macOS Sequoia怎么设置代理完整流程适合哪些卖家/平台/地区/类目?
适用于具备基础命令行能力的技术型跨境运营者、独立站开发者、广告优化师;典型场景包括:Amazon多站点IP隔离、Shopify主题A/B测试、Temu/TikTok Shop类目合规性页面快照采集;不推荐纯小白卖家直接使用,因故障排查依赖终端日志分析能力。
OpenClaw(龙虾)在macOS Sequoia怎么设置代理完整流程常见失败原因是什么?如何排查?
最常见失败原因为:① 钥匙串未设证书为‘始终信任’导致HTTPS失败;② 终端无‘完全磁盘访问’权限导致无法读取配置;③ 系统代理端口与OpenClaw启动端口不一致。排查方法:终端运行 lsof -i :8080 确认端口监听状态;执行 openclaw --help 核对参数拼写;查看控制台App中“system.log”筛选“openclaw”关键词。
结尾
OpenClaw是轻量、可控、可审计的本地代理方案,适配macOS Sequoia,但需严格遵循系统权限与证书配置规范。
关联词条
活动
服务
百科
问答
文章
社群
跨境企业

